Taxonomic Classification

Rank Gray Mouse Opossum Short-Haired Leafwalker
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Didelphimorphia (Didelphimorphia) Diptera (Diptera)
Family Didelphidae Syrphidae
Genus Tlacuatzin Chalcosyrphus
Species Tlacuatzin canescens Chalcosyrphus piger

Evolutionary Relationship

Gray Mouse Opossum and Short-Haired Leafwalker share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
